What is Shockwave Therapy?

Shockwave Therapy is a non-invasive treatment that harnesses the power of acoustic waves to kickstart the body’s natural healing processes. Initially developed to break down kidney stones, this technology has evolved into an effective treatment for various musculoskeletal conditions. It helps alleviate pain and, moreover, promotes tissue regeneration, offering a promising option for those seeking relief and recovery.

How Does it Work?

The core principle of Shockwave Therapy involves sending high-energy sound waves to the affected area. Consequently, these waves interact with the tissues, leading to several therapeutic effects:

  1. Stimulation of Blood Flow: The acoustic waves enhance blood circulation in the targeted area, thereby bringing more oxygen and nutrients to aid in healing.
  2. Reduction of Pain: Shockwaves have an analgesic effect, thereby reducing pain signals and providing relief.
  3. Promotion of Tissue Repair: The therapy encourages the production of collagen, a crucial component for repairing damaged tissues.
  4. Breaking Down Calcified Deposits: In conditions like calcific tendonitis, Shockwave Therapy helps break down calcium deposits, alleviating pain and restoring function.

Conditions Treated by Shockwave Therapy

Shockwave Therapy in Cambridge effectively treats a variety of conditions, including but not limited to:

  • Plantar Fasciitis
  • Achilles Tendinopathy
  • Tennis Elbow
  • Shoulder Pain (e.g., rotator cuff issues)
  • Patellar Tendinopathy (Jumper’s Knee)
  • Myofascial Pain Syndrome

What to Expect During a Session

Understanding what happens during a Shockwave Therapy session can ease any apprehension. Here’s a step-by-step guide to what you can expect:

Initial Consultation

Before you commence treatment at The Cambridge Physiotherapy Clinic, you’ll undergo an initial consultation. Firstly, a physiotherapist will assess your condition, then review your medical history, and subsequently decide if Shockwave Therapy is the best option for you.

The Procedure

  1. Preparation: The area to be treated is exposed, and a gel is applied to facilitate the transmission of shockwaves.
  2. Application: A handheld device is used to deliver shockwaves to the affected area. Additionally, the intensity and frequency of the waves can be adjusted based on your condition and tolerance.
  3. Duration: Each session typically lasts between 15 to 20 minutes.

Sensations During Treatment

You might notice a tapping or pulsating feeling during the therapy. However, it’s normal to experience some discomfort, especially at higher intensities. Nevertheless, most people find it manageable.

Post-Treatment

After your session, it’s normal to feel some mild soreness or swelling in the treated area. However, don’t worry; this usually goes away in a few days. Additionally, your physiotherapist will give you some care instructions to help you recover quickly.

When to Choose Shockwave Therapy

  1. When Conservative Treatments Fail:

If traditional methods like rest, ice, compression, and elevation (RICE), physical therapy, or medication have not provided sufficient relief, Shockwave Therapy may be a viable next step. Its ability to target and heal chronic conditions makes it an attractive alternative when conservative treatments are ineffective.

  1. For Chronic Conditions:

It is particularly effective for chronic conditions that have persisted for more than six months. It provides a non-surgical option that can address the underlying issues causing prolonged pain and discomfort.

  1. To Avoid Surgery:

For patients seeking to avoid the risks and recovery time associated with surgery, It offers a compelling alternative. It can often achieve similar results without the need for invasive procedures.

  1. When Quick Recovery is Desired:

Athletes and active individuals often prefer Shockwave Therapy due to its minimal downtime. The quick sessions and rapid recovery allow them to return to their activities sooner compared to more invasive treatments.

Combining Shockwave Therapy with Other Treatments

In some cases, Shockwave Therapy can be used in conjunction with other treatments to enhance overall results. For instance, combining it with physiotherapy can improve mobility and strength while also addressing pain and inflammation.
